<p>There are reports Russia is attacking Gori by air; Gori is outside that disputed region called Osettia.  The capital of Georgia, Tbskbkt@$#%ilivanili or something, is getting refugees and the govt. offices are vacated.</p>

<p>But holy fuck the Georgians are actually fighting Russia.</p>

<p>Can't figure out the right or wrong of the disputed region.  Some reports says it is part of Georgia, others call it a break away region under de facto Russian control etc.  Russia says Georgia started it by attacking Russian "peacekeepers" in Osettia, Georgia blames Russia, etc. </p>

<p>Interesting fact: Georgia has this 1000 mile pipeline connecting Caspian sea oil to the Black sea and thus W. Europe.  This pipeline is outside of Russia's control.<br />
Russia does not like it that Georgia wants to be part of NATO.  </p>
